'Stand With Palestine' Initiative Led by Students of Qatar Academy Doha Raised QR20m

Doha, Qatar: The 'Stand with Palestine' initiative, led by Qatar Foundation’s Qatar Academy Doha (QAD) students, raised QR20m following a successful event at the Education City Stadium on 15 December. The fundraising campaign, intended to aid the Palestinian community, drew over 27,000 individuals to the Qatar 2022 venue. Notably, several celebrities and students participated in a friendly match between Qatar and Palestine.

Minister of Sports and Youth H E Salah bin Ghanim Al Ali, Vice-Chairperson and CEO of Qatar Foundation (QF) HE Sheikha Hind bint Hamad Al Thani, and other dignitaries attended the event.

Students from Qatar Academy Doha (QAD), a part of QF's Pre-University Education, initiated the fundraising drive with the objective of engaging the local community and providing them with an opportunity to show their solidarity with the people of Palestine.

The funds generated from the sale of football match tickets will be directed towards supporting relief efforts for Palestinians. Furthermore, for individuals interested in contributing beyond the ticket price, a dedicated online link has been established in partnership with Qatar Charity, providing direct access to official channels dedicated to relief efforts in Palestine.

The initiative encompassed an array of events, activities, and performances. To commence the event, artists Nasser Al Kubaisi, Dana Al Meer, Nesma Emad, and Hala Al Imadi presented a musical act with a Palestinian theme, captivating the audience with their renditions of "Palestine is Arab" and "My Homeland." The event also showcased a stunning display of illuminated drones, and a prize draw conducted during the half-time of the match.
